使用Vue.js和Perl語言開發可擴展的網路爬蟲和資料處理工具的指南和最佳實踐
一、簡介
網路爬蟲和資料處理工具在當今大數據時代中扮演著非常重要的角色。本文將介紹如何使用Vue.js和Perl語言來開發可擴展的網路爬蟲和資料處理工具,並分享一些最佳實踐和程式碼範例。
二、技術選型
三、建置開發環境
vue create crawler-tool cd crawler-tool
npm install vue-router
四、設計資料流程
在開發網路爬蟲和資料處理工具時,需要設計清晰的資料流程,以便將前端介面與後端處理邏輯連結起來。
五、編寫程式碼範例
以下是一個簡單的程式碼範例,展示如何使用Vue.js和Perl來實作一個基本的網頁抓取和資料處理功能。
<template> <div> <input v-model="url" type="text" placeholder="请输入URL"> <button @click="crawl">爬取</button> <div>{{ result }}</div> </div> </template> <script> export default { data() { return { url: '', result: '' } }, methods: { crawl() { // 调用后端Perl脚本进行网页抓取处理 this.$http.post('/api/crawler', { url: this.url }).then(response => { this.result = response.data; }); } } } </script>
#!/usr/bin/perl use strict; use warnings; use LWP::Simple; my $url = param('url'); my $content = get($url); # 使用LWP::Simple模块从URL获取网页内容 # 对网页内容进行处理,例如提取特定数据,存储到数据库等 # 返回处理结果 print "网页内容:$content";
六、最佳實踐
七、總結
本文介紹如何使用Vue.js和Perl語言開發可擴展的網路爬蟲和資料處理工具,並分享了一些最佳實踐和程式碼範例。希望讀者可以透過本文的指導,更好地利用這兩種技術來處理和分析大量的網路數據。
以上是使用Vue.js和Perl語言開發可擴展的網路爬蟲和資料處理工具的指南和最佳實踐的詳細內容。更多資訊請關注PHP中文網其他相關文章!